KDevelop 5.6 wordt geleverd met verbeteringen voor C ++, Python en meer

Na zes maanden ontwikkeling werd het uitgebracht die van de geïntegreerde programmeeromgeving KDevelop 5.6, dat het ontwikkelingsproces van KDE 5 volledig ondersteunt, inclusief het gebruik van Clang als compiler.

binnen van de veranderingen die zijn gemaakt in deze nieuwe versie verbeteringen voor CMake, php, C ++, python zijn gemarkeerd en ook verbeteringen in de aangeboden tools.

Voor degenen die niet bekend zijn met KDevelop, moet u dat weten het is een geïntegreerde ontwikkelomgeving voor GNU / Linux-Unix-systemen, evenals voor Windows, die ook van plan zijn om het in Mac OS-versie te lanceren, KDevelop Het is gepubliceerd onder de GPL-licentie en bedoeld voor gebruik in de grafische omgeving van KDE, hoewel het ook werkt met andere omgevingen, zoals Gnome.

In tegenstelling tot veel andere ontwikkelingsinterfaces, KDevelop heeft geen eigen compiler, dus het vertrouwt op gcc om binaire code te produceren. De nieuwste versie is momenteel in ontwikkeling en werkt met verschillende programmeertalen.

Van hen kunnen we enkele markeren, zoals C, C ++, PHP en Python door een officiële plug-in te installeren. Andere talen zoals Java, Ada, SQL, Perl en Pascal, evenals scripts voor de Bash-shell, zijn nog niet naar KDevelop4 geport, hoewel ze in de toekomst mogelijk worden ondersteund.

kdevelop het is volledig compatibel met het ontwikkelingsproces van KDE 5, inclusief het gebruik van Clang als compiler. De projectcode gebruikt de KDE Frameworks 5- en Qt 5-bibliotheken.

KDevelop 5.6 Belangrijkste nieuwe functies

In deze nieuwe versie van KDevelop verbeterde ondersteuning voor CMake-projecten wordt geïntroduceerd, naast de mogelijkheid om cmake build-doelen in verschillende submappen te groeperen en naast het importeren van projecten is cmake-file-api erbij betrokken. Verbeterde foutafhandeling.

Daarnaast is benadrukt het werk dat is gedaan om de tools voor ontwikkeling in C ++ te verbeteren, aangezien uit de verbeteringen duidelijk is dat de mogelijkheid om willekeurige compilatievlaggen door te geven bij het aanroepen van clang werd toegevoegd.

Wat betreft de talen, we kunnen een s vindenVerbeterde PHP-taalondersteuning. Het php-bestand "functions.php" is bijgewerkt en PHP 7.1-syntaxisafhandeling is toegevoegd om meerdere uitzonderingen op te vangen.

Ook Opgemerkt wordt dat ondersteuning voor Python 3.9 is toegevoegd en ondersteuning voor assemblages met MSVC ++ 19.24 is geïmplementeerd.

Van de andere veranderingen die zich onderscheiden van deze nieuwe versie:

  • Geoptimaliseerde uitbreiding van omgevingsvariabelen en de mogelijkheid toegevoegd om aan het dollarteken te ontsnappen met een backslash in omgevingsvariabelen.
  • Toetsenbordfocus voor plasmoid is opgelost.
  • Toon lege sessies in de data-engine.
  • Verwijder de alias "text / x-diff" uit ondersteunde MIME-typen.
  • Het ondersteunt ook de nieuwe naam KSysGuard voor wat voorheen KF5SysGuard heette.
  • Uitbreiding van omgevingsvariabelen is geoptimaliseerd en verbeterd.
  • Recursie wordt vermeden bij het uitbreiden van omgevingsvariabelen.
  • Er is een oplossing gemaakt met Ctrl + mouse_scroll voor de zoom van de documentatieweergave.
  • Zoomfactor van documentweergave hersteld met Ctrl + 0.
  • Met de muis heen en weer navigeren is nu mogelijk vanaf de homepagina's van CMake en ManPage.
  • Correcte navigatie in documentatieweergave met behulp van de muisknoppen terug en vooruit.
  • Update wordt niet geforceerd bij het herladen van projecten.

Als u meer wilt weten over deze nieuw uitgebrachte versie, kunt u de details raadplegen door naar naar de volgende link.

Hoe installeer ik KDevelop 5.6 op Ubuntu en derivaten?

Ten slotte kunnen degenen die deze ontwikkelomgeving willen testen, het installatieprogramma verkrijgen van de volgende link.

Bij, u zult de downloadlinks van de nieuwe versie kunnen vinden KDevelop 5.6 voor de verschillende besturingssystemen die het ondersteunt. In het geval van degenen die Linux-gebruikers zijn, kunnen ze het AppImage-bestand gebruiken die kan worden verkregen en uitgevoerd met behulp van een terminal door de volgende opdrachten in te typen:

wget -O KDevelop.AppImage https://download.kde.org/stable/kdevelop/5.6.0/bin/linux/KDevelop-5.6.0-x86_64.AppImage chmod +x KDevelop.AppImage ./KDevelop.AppImage

Ten slotte, als u twijfels heeft over het gebruik of de configuratie van KDevelop, kunt u zowel tutorials als informatie erover raadplegen op internet of YouTube.


Laat je reactie achter

Uw e-mailadres wordt niet gepubliceerd. Verplichte velden zijn gemarkeerd met *

*

*

  1. Verantwoordelijk voor de gegevens: Miguel Ángel Gatón
  2. Doel van de gegevens: Controle SPAM, commentaarbeheer.
  3. Legitimatie: uw toestemming
  4. Mededeling van de gegevens: De gegevens worden niet aan derden meegedeeld, behalve op grond van wettelijke verplichting.
  5. Gegevensopslag: database gehost door Occentus Networks (EU)
  6. Rechten: u kunt uw gegevens op elk moment beperken, herstellen en verwijderen.

  1.   Gian Carlo Dennis zei

    Hallo, je blog is ongelooflijk, ik zal mijn programmeervrienden uitnodigen om je blog te volgen.
    Kop op!!!!
    Ga zo door en je zult meer programmeurs aantrekken.